首页
/ 【3步突破限制】Cursor Pro永久免费使用的技术实现方案

【3步突破限制】Cursor Pro永久免费使用的技术实现方案

2026-03-31 09:18:09作者:秋阔奎Evelyn

一、问题剖析:设备标识与额度管理机制解析

1.1 软件授权核心技术原理

现代软件授权系统普遍采用多维度设备指纹识别技术,Cursor Pro通过组合硬件标识符(UUID)、系统配置信息和用户行为数据构建唯一设备身份。这种身份标识直接关联到额度分配系统,形成闭环的使用限制机制。

1.2 额度限制的技术实现路径

Cursor Pro的额度管理采用三层控制架构:基础层基于设备UUID的总量控制、中间层通过会话令牌的使用计数、应用层实施功能级别的权限校验。当任一维度触发阈值时,系统会激活付费订阅提示。

1.3 现有解决方案的技术瓶颈

传统破解方法多采用修改内存数据或拦截API请求,这类方案存在稳定性差、易被检测的问题。随着软件安全机制升级,静态修改方法的生命周期通常不超过30天,需要持续更新维护。

二、方案原理:设备标识重置技术架构

2.1 核心架构设计思路

cursor-free-everyday采用设备标识全链路重置方案,通过内核级系统调用修改关键标识信息,实现从硬件层到应用层的身份信息刷新。该架构包含三个核心模块:标识生成器、配置清理器和状态验证器。

2.2 技术实现关键点

  • UUID动态生成算法:基于系统时间戳和随机熵池创建不可预测的硬件标识符
  • 配置文件重定向技术:通过符号链接机制隔离原始配置与重置后配置
  • 进程内存净化:实时监控并清理残留的身份信息缓存

2.3 与传统方案的技术差异

相较于虚拟机方案(资源占用高)和修改注册表方法(稳定性差),本方案采用用户态轻量级实现,内存占用低于5MB,重置过程无需重启系统,平均处理时间控制在15秒以内。

三、实施指南:分场景操作步骤

3.1 环境检查与准备

# 克隆项目仓库
git clone https://gitcode.com/gh_mirrors/cu/cursor-free-everyday
cd cursor-free-everyday

# 检查系统兼容性
cargo check

系统要求:Linux kernel 4.15+,glibc 2.27+,至少100MB可用磁盘空间

3.2 执行设备重置流程

🔧 步骤1:关闭所有Cursor相关进程

# 终止Cursor进程
pkill -f "Cursor"

🔧 步骤2:运行重置工具

# 执行主程序
cargo run --release

🔧 步骤3:确认重置结果 工具执行完成后将显示"重置成功"提示,并生成重置报告文件reset_report.log

3.3 验证与故障排除

# 查看重置状态
cat reset_report.log | grep "status"

常见问题解决

  • 重置失败:检查是否有Cursor进程残留,使用lsof | grep Cursor查找隐藏进程
  • 额度未更新:删除~/.cursor目录后重试
  • 权限错误:使用sudo执行或检查/dev/random访问权限

Cursor Pro免费助手操作界面

四、价值验证:不同技术场景的应用效果

4.1 独立开发者使用场景

案例:前端开发者在React项目重构中,需要大量使用AI辅助生成组件代码。通过每周一次的计划性重置,实现了持续的高质量AI辅助,项目开发周期缩短40%。

4.2 企业开发团队应用

案例:某创业团队10人开发小组,通过部署本工具实现团队共享额度管理,每月节省订阅成本800美元,同时避免了多人共用账号的安全风险。

4.3 开源项目维护场景

案例:开源工具维护者通过自动化重置脚本,在CI/CD流程中集成AI代码审查,显著提升了代码质量,bug修复时间从平均2小时缩短至30分钟。

五、技术原理图解

5.1 重置流程数据流向

  1. 系统信息采集模块获取当前设备标识
  2. 标识生成器创建新的硬件UUID
  3. 配置清理器遍历并修改相关配置文件
  4. 会话管理器清除残留的身份验证令牌
  5. 状态验证器确认新标识生效

5.2 核心算法工作原理

UUID生成采用改进版UUIDv4算法,在标准实现基础上增加系统特征熵值,确保生成的标识既符合规范又具备设备唯一性,同时避免被服务端检测为伪造标识。

六、进阶使用技巧

6.1 自动化重置配置

创建定时任务实现自动重置:

# 添加每日自动重置(Linux系统)
echo "0 3 * * * cd /path/to/cursor-free-everyday && cargo run --release > /dev/null 2>&1" | crontab -

6.2 多用户环境配置

为团队共享使用配置独立环境变量:

# 设置独立工作目录
export CURSOR_FREE_HOME=/opt/cursor-free-team

七、生态集成

7.1 与代码编辑器集成

VS Code扩展开发示例:

// 集成重置功能到编辑器命令面板
const resetCursor = () => {
  const { execSync } = require('child_process');
  execSync('cd /path/to/cursor-free-everyday && cargo run --release');
};

7.2 与开发工作流集成

在package.json中添加脚本:

{
  "scripts": {
    "reset-cursor": "cd /path/to/cursor-free-everyday && cargo run --release"
  }
}

通过这套完整的技术方案,开发者可以突破Cursor Pro的额度限制,同时保持系统稳定性和操作安全性。工具的开源特性确保了透明可审计,用户可以完全掌控重置过程,避免第三方依赖带来的安全风险。

登录后查看全文
热门项目推荐
相关项目推荐